21ic问答首页 - FPGA、DSP、ASIC的区别是什么
相关问题
- ads8866跟dsp28335通信问题1 回答
- 贴片MOS管测温11 回答
- TMS320F280049使用SPI作为从机通讯和ADC采样冲突问题4 回答
- 为什么POMS截止是漏极还会有对地电压0 回答
- PMOS开关电路关断后输出仍有电压0 回答
- GD32G553 TMU3 回答
- lksscope闪退0 回答
- tms320f28377s生成hex文件的时候报错0 回答
- 使用McBSP模拟SPI进行收发数据,通过DMA怎么进行发送呢0 回答
- 有懂硬件(开发板)集成的人么0 回答

问答
赞0
评论
2020-11-25
赞0
评论
2020-11-24
赞0
DSP:是ASIC,如同CPU/GPU一样,适合量产,降低成本,缺点是(硬件)设计一旦确定,便不易于修改。 DSP实际应该称为DSPs,即用于DSP处理的专用芯片。跟普通计算机的区别一方面是他是哈佛结构的,也就是数据和程序空间分开。(普通计算机是冯 诺依曼结构)另一方面他有流水线结构,不过现在其他也有了,见贤思齐。再一方面他有专用的硬件算法电路,用以完成DSP运算,比如最基本的乘法累加。上过 DSP的就知道,蝶形算法FFT什么的,拆成最基本单元就是乘法累加,把这部分加速了,整体性能就有非常大的提高。
ASIC原本就是专门为某一项功能开发的专用集成芯片,比如你看摄像头里面的芯片,小小的一片,集成度很低,成本很低,可是够用了。一个山寨摄像头卖才卖 30块,买一片ARM多少钱?后来ASIC发展了一些,称为半定制专用集成电路,相对来说更接近FPGA,甚至在某些地方,ASIC就是个大概 念,FPGA属于ASIC之下的一部分。
评论
2020-11-23
您需要登录后才可以回复 登录 | 注册